QUICK QUESTIONS TO ASK ABOUT THE MAN YOU'RE SHOPPING FOR:

  • What item has he been dreaming about? If there's that one item that he's been talking about forever but that he hasn't bought because he can't afford it/thinks it's a little frivolous/has been too busy, this would make the ideal gift since he probably won't buy it for himself.
  • How does he spend his spare time? What does he talk about doing the most, and what does he try to get you interested in?
  • What's his personality like? Is he the practical type who would prefer his gift to be purely functional, or does he want all the bells and whistles and decorative accents? Does he want all the toys, or does he aspire to live life as simply as possible? Take this into consideration when choosing his gift as you don't want to buy something that would seem wasteful to him, or conversely, that he finds boring.
  • Does he like being in control? If your man has definite ideas about what he likes, it might be a good idea to give him a gift card so he can choose exactly what he wants. Your best bet is to get a gift card for a store that has a wide variety of items, and don't forget that you can sometimes get deals on Christmas gift cards.
